Processing Power

Both the Athlon XP 2400+ and Athlon XP 2100+ share an identical 1-core/1-thread configuration. Boost clocks reach 2 GHz on the Athlon XP 2400+ versus 1.73 GHz on the Athlon XP 2100+ — a 14.5% clock advantage for the Athlon XP 2400+. The Athlon XP 2400+ uses the Thorton (2001−2003) architecture (130 nm), while the Athlon XP 2100+ uses Thoroughbred (2001−2002) (180 nm). In PassMark, the Athlon XP 2400+ scores 305 against the Athlon XP 2100+'s 265 — a 14% lead for the Athlon XP 2400+. Both processors carry 0 kB of L3 cache.
